Skattebo is upgraded for Week 2 at Rams despite being a road dog; he impressed last year in eight games as a rookie (617 yards, 7 TDs) and was especially remarkable in his four full starts (398 yards, 4 TDs) before an ankle injury cut his season short. In Week 1, Skattebo had 81 yards and 1 TD on 18 carries. He has circumstantial edges: HC John Harbaugh is great on the road (90-64-6 ATS, 13.7% ROI) and as a dog of at least +3 (42-25-3 ATS, 21.1% ROI); the Rams could be exhausted after traveling almost 16,000 miles to Australia and back; EDGE Myles Garrett (knee, IR) is out; SS Kamren Curl (ankle) exited Week 1 with an injury; and DT Aaron Donald (rest) could be rusty in his first game in over two years.
